The Global Synthetic Rope Market: Highlights

Synthetic rope offers many advantages over steel rope, such as higher corrosion resistance, fatigue resistance, weather and chemical resistance, and light weighting. It is widely preferred in the many industries, such as marine & fishing, mining, oil & gas, building & construction, and sports industry. It has been continuously gaining market acceptance over the last few decades by replacing steel ropes. Synthetic rope is about one seventh of the weight of similar sized wire rope.

The Global Synthetic Graphite Market- Highlights

Synthetic graphite, also called as artificial graphite, is a man-made substance manufactured by the high temperature treatment (2,500 to 3,000 degree Celsius) of amorphous carbon materials. It is manufactured by calcination and subsequent graphitization of petroleum coke and can achieve purity of 99.9% carbon. The types of amorphous carbon used as precursors to graphite are many, and can be derived from petroleum, coal, or natural and synthetic organic materials. Synthetic graphite holds major share in the pie of the global graphite market.

Synthetic Graphite Market- Insights by form

Synthetic graphite has four principal types; electrode, block, powder, and fiber. The largest type of the synthetic graphite is graphite electrode that is predominately used in the electric arc furnaces for melting steel & iron and producing alloys.

Synthetic graphite blocks are also man-made products and are made using petroleum coke. Blocks are produced from isostatic, extruded, die molded, and vibration molded process. All these processes offer distinctive benefits and are used for producing graphite for different applications. Synthetic blocks are used in the large variety of applications ranging from polysilicon production for photovoltaic industry to high temperature reactors in nuclear industry.

Synthetic graphite powder is a low cost material because it’s a by-product. It is used in applications, such as brake linings, lubricants and carbon brush. Synthetic graphite powder is generally a result of the granular graphite or graphite dust gathered during machining electrodes and blocks.

The Global Metal Coated Fiber Market: Highlights

Metal coated fibers use pure metals of nickel, copper, aluminum, and gold to have higher temperature resistance, better conductivity, and higher strength than polymer coated fibers. Polymer coated fibers can operate at temperatures of up to 300 degrees Celsius, whereas metal coated fibers can withstand temperatures of up to 700 degrees Celsius for short periods or 500 degrees Celsius for longer periods.

The High-Performance Glass Fiber Market: Highlights

The global high-performance glass fiber market offers a healthy growth opportunity over the next five years and will reach an estimated value of US$ 390.6 million in 2023. High specific strength and modulus than E-glass fiber and lower cost than other advanced fibers, such as carbon fiber make it a preferred material for high-performance applications. Increasing automotive production and aircraft deliveries, and increasing high-performance fiber penetration in performance-driven applications, such as helicopter blade and ballistic armor, are the key growth drivers of the high-performance glass fiber market.

High-performance fibers were developed for military applications during 1960’s and are known by various names, such as S-glass in the USA, R-glass in Europe, and T-glass in Japan. It has a tensile strength of approximately 700 KSI and tensile modulus of up to 14 MSI. High-performance glass fiber is 40% to 70% stronger than E-glass fiber due to higher silica oxide, aluminum oxide, and magnesium oxide content than E-glass fiber. The usage of high-performance glass fibers is in very niche applications in aerospace & defense, automotive, sporting goods, wind energy, and other industries.

The Global High Performance Fiber Market: Highlights

The demand of lightweight products at superior strength is the core requirement in the high performance industries, such as aerospace and defense. Similarly, the strict government regulations in the automotive industry, such as CAFÉ standard are putting pressure on OEMs to curb the overall vehicle weight to achieve high fuel efficiency and reduce carbon emission. These are some of the factors compelling OEMs to develop products leveraging high performance fibers in the structural applications, such as aircraft fuselage & wings, automotive monocoque, wind blades, and ballistic armor. High performance fibers include carbon fiber (PAN and Pitch), aramid fiber (Meta and Para), S-glass fiber, Polybenzimidazole (PBI) Fiber, High-Strength PE Fiber, Boron fiber, and Polyphenylene sulfide (PPS) Fiber.
